Role and responsibilities
- You will complete repairs to customers' homes and conduct pre- and post-inspections, recording actions and outcomes.
- You will carry out general repairs to properties and communal areas as directed by your supervisor or line manager, ensuring all work complies with Health & Safety guidelines and company policies.
- You will monitor expenditure, maintain accurate records, and focus on reducing costs while delivering value for money to customers.
- You will assist with scheduling work, supervise and train apprentices where applicable, and undertake training as directed by your line manager.
This role requires a satisfactory Basic DBS check as part of employment checks.
Essential criteria
- Have an NVQ Level 2 qualification or City & Guilds
- Hold a valid driving license
More about you
- You must be technically competent with an NVQ Level 2 or City & Guilds qualification in your trade.
- Strong organisational skills are essential for planning workloads and estimating supplies and time.
- A positive attitude towards health and safety, fostering a compliant culture, is crucial.
- Good communication skills are required, along with the ability to use a tablet or smartphone for recording activities, capturing images, and recording survey data.
- A current driving licence is essential, and a Level 2 qualification in additional trades is preferred.
